Chartwells Higher Education invites you to embark on an exciting journey as a Food Service Director at Mills College at Northeastern University. Mills College, located in the heart of Oakland, California, is part of Northeastern Universitys global university system. Known for its commitment to social justice, equity, and womens education, Mills offers a dynamic and diverse community with a focus on transformative learning experiences.
